Carriages for disabled persons; whether or not motorised or otherwise mechanically propelled

HS v2022 Code: 8713

About carriages for disabled persons; whether or not motorised or otherwise mechanically propelled

HS code 8713 covers a critical segment of the assistive technology industry, encompassing carriages and mobility devices designed for individuals with disabilities. These products play a vital role in enhancing the independence, accessibility, and quality of life for millions of people worldwide. As a key component of the broader healthcare and rehabilitation ecosystem, the 8713 industry is closely tied to advancements in medical technology, ergonomics, and inclusive design.

Production process

The production of carriages and mobility devices under HS code 8713 typically involves a combination of advanced manufacturing techniques and meticulous craftsmanship. Manufacturers utilize a range of materials, including lightweight yet durable metals, high-performance plastics, and specialized fabrics, to create products that are both functional and aesthetically pleasing. The assembly process often involves precision engineering, custom-fitting, and rigorous testing to ensure the safety, comfort, and reliability of each unit.

Production inputs

The 8713 industry relies on a diverse array of inputs, including raw materials such as aluminum, steel, and composite materials, as well as specialized components like motors, batteries, and control systems. Manufacturers also require access to advanced manufacturing equipment, such as computer-aided design (CAD) software, 3D printing technologies, and precision assembly tools. Additionally, the industry benefits from a skilled workforce with expertise in engineering, ergonomics, and product design.

Production outputs

The primary output of the 8713 industry is a wide range of carriages, wheelchairs, and other mobility devices designed to assist individuals with physical disabilities. These products are often tailored to meet the specific needs of users, ranging from manual wheelchairs to power-operated scooters and specialized mobility aids. The output of the 8713 industry is closely linked to other HS codes, such as 9021 Orthopedic appliances, including crutches, surgical belts and trusses; splints and other fracture appliances; artificial parts of the body; hearing aids and other appliances which are worn or carried, or implanted in the body, to compensate for a defect or disability, which encompass a broader range of assistive technologies and medical devices.
